How they compare

Australia currently reports 27.74 against 26.62 in Guinea, a difference of 1.12.

Across all 6 years both countries report, Australia has been ahead every year.

Australia ranks 165th and Guinea ranks 166th of 188 countries.

The score for the cost for border compliance to export benchmarks economies with respect to the regulatory best practice on the indicator. The score ranges from 0 to 100, where 0 represents the worst regulatory performance and 100 the best regulatory performance, and is computed based on the methodology in the DB16-20 studies.
